Any upholstered furniture or mattress that is made from or contains nonflame retardant cellular foam shall be labeled in a manner approved by the chief. On and after January 1, 2004, all bedding that is made from or contains nonflame retardant cellular foam shall also be labeled in a manner approved by the chief. Notwithstanding the provisions of this section, no label is required for a product that complies with the regulations required by Section 19161 or with applicable federal flammability regulations.
Cal. Bus. & Prof. Code § 19089.5
Labeling
